What the HealthMarkets Insurance Agency TV commercial - Coverage Limitations is about.

In this HealthMarkets Insurance Agency TV spot, titled 'Coverage Limitations,' the renowned comedian Bill Engvall takes center stage to shed light on some important aspects of insurance coverage.

The commercial opens with a relaxed and approachable Bill Engvall seated in a comfortable living room overlooking a picturesque landscape. As he begins to speak, his familiar humor shines through, engaging viewers instantly. Engvall, known for his wit and charm, effortlessly captivates the audience's attention.

In a warm and conversational tone, Engvall delicately addresses the topic of coverage limitations, showcasing his knack for simplifying complex concepts. He acknowledges that while insurance policies are designed to protect us, it's crucial to understand the extent of coverage and any limitations that may exist.

Engvall proceeds to explain how HealthMarkets Insurance Agency educates individuals on the nuances of insurance, making it easier for them to make informed decisions. He emphasizes that HealthMarkets Insurance Agency takes the time to understand the specific needs of each client, ensuring that they find a policy that aligns with their lifestyle and budget.

As the spot continues, Engvall injects his signature humor, ensuring that the message remains light-hearted and accessible. His genuine enthusiasm for helping others shines through as he emphasizes the importance of finding the right coverage.

The TV spot concludes with Engvall encouraging viewers to reach out to HealthMarkets Insurance Agency for personalized guidance. A contact number and website address flash across the screen, making it easy for interested individuals to take action and secure the coverage they need.

With this captivating and humorous advertisement, HealthMarkets Insurance Agency effectively communicates the significance of understanding insurance coverage limitations. Bill Engvall's down-to-earth demeanor and comedic approach create a memorable and engaging experience, leaving viewers entertained and empowered to make informed decisions about their insurance needs.

HealthMarkets Insurance Agency TV commercial - Coverage Limitations produced for HealthMarkets Insurance Agency was first shown on television on October 16, 2018.
